The aim is the goal of the experiment, for example, you may be turning milk into plastic. So the aim is to turn milk into plastic. The hypothesis is what you THINK will happen. So you might think that the milk will turn into a substance quite unlike plastic. So the aim can be quite different to a hypothesis, or very similar!

What is a hypothesis and how is it derived this is a dang 7th graders work people?

A hypothesis is an educated guess based on facts and other empirical evidence. Generally a hypothesis what you assume will be the result of an experiment.


Types of Hypothesis and definition?

In formal design and analysis of experiments there are but two types of hypotheses: null and alternative. And one might argue there really is only one because when the null is properly defined, the alternative is automatically properly defined. The null hypothesis is a testable statement of conjecture. The purpose of the null hypothesis is to set the measurable goal for the experiment that follows to show that the null is not false. If the results of the experiment do not show that then the alternative hypothesis is by definition not false. Simple Example: Null: It's raining outside. Alt: It's NOT raining outside. NOTE: The NOT reverses the logic of the null. The experiment...walk outside. The test...if I get wet, the Null is not false. If I don't get wet, the alternative is not false. NOTE: I must have an experiment to test the hypothesis. Without a test it's not a valid hypothesis.

How do you write a hypothesis?

Think about the aim of the experiment. Relate the hypothesis to this. A hypothesis is an educated guess of what you think will happen in the experiment. For example, if you're doing an experiment on the quality of different fertilizers, choose which fertilizer you think will be most effective and state this as your hypothesis.
